Julieta Norma Fierro Gossman (Mexico City, February 24, 1948) best known as Julieta Fierro is a Mexican astrophysicist and science communicator. She is a full researcher at the Institute of Astronomy and professor of the Sciences Faculty at the National Autonomous University of Mexico (UNAM). She is part of the Researchers National System in Mexico, holding a level III position. Since 2004 she is a member of the Mexican Academy of Language.

For the person who asked for diminutives, Julieta is usually shortened to Juli (pronounced sort of like *hoo*-lee), and occasionally Julie, like Julie Gonzalo, for example. Not sure why you were told Juli is wrong?
Julieta Madrigal is the mother of Mirabel, Luisa, and Isabela in the 2021 Disney film Encanto. Her gift is the ability to heal others through the meals she cooks.
This name is also the Georgian form of Juliet. It is written as ჯულიეტა in Georgian and pronounced as: /d͡ʒuliɛtʼa/Sources used:
